TARANAKI'S DAY.

DEFEAT OF NORTHLAND. The first League trial to help the selectors choose the side for England, between Taranaki and Northland, provided a rugged exhibition of the code with an occasional glimpse of concerted action. Territorially honours rested with Taranaki. and they finally ran out the winners by 29 points to l'i. Only one point separated the teams at the Interval, when Taranaki led by six points to five. Following the change-over Northland played with more dash than they had shown at any stage in the match and took the lead by eight points to six. Thereafter, however, Taranaki were usually on top, and they went on to win convincingly. For the winners G. Oronin gave a splendid exhibition at full-back, while others who were impressive were W. Lewis and S. Mcßoberts (three-quarters), T. Fenton and J. Matuku (five-eighths) and D. Keenan (half-back). Fenton was resource? ful throughout and exhibited fine understanding with his supports. The pick of

the Northland backs were F. Bradley (halfback). W. Murray (five-eighth) and W Flesher and B. Pickrell (three-quarter). The Tarangaki forwards were superior to the sextet from the north, grafting hard in tight and loose, and generally being up with play to assist their backs in passing bouts. R. Hiekland, L. Clarke, and A Mitchell were the pick of the bunch. P. Pickrang, the former I'onsonhy and Manukau forward, was one of the best forwards on the ground, and from first to last he was going great guns for Northland. His best' support came from Crump and V Payne.

Scorers for the winners were W, Lewis Hiekland. Mcßoberts, Yeates, Keenan (2)\ and Clarke, while Clarke converted four tries. Try-getters for Northland were Pickrank, R. Hamilton and Flesher, while S. Hamilton converted on two occasions.
